U.S. Overseas Loans and Grants - Green Book, U.S. economic and military assistance to other countries: data given in historical (current) and constant dollars. Search by country or program. Default setting is ten year cumulations with individual years for the past five. Use custom setting to select one country for individual years, 1946 to present.
